Abstract

Breast milk (ASI) is the most important and best natural food for babies. The cause of low milk production can be from poor balanced nutritional factors, mental health problems such as stress or depression so that you feel anxious, trauma after using hormonal contraceptives and breast care that is not done properly. Low milk production is also caused by a lack of stimulation of the hormone oxytocin on the first day after delivery. The impact of low milk production is that mothers do not give exclusive breastfeeding to their babies. Management of low milk production can be done by fulfilling sufficient nutrition in breastfeeding mothers. This type of research is to determine the effect of moringa leaf and papaya fruit extracts on increasing breast milk production at the Munjul Health Center in 2024. Qualitative with a case study approach. There was an increase in breast milk production in breastfeeding mothers who were given moringa leaf extracts and young papaya fruits. The administration of moringa leaf extract is 10 ml more than that given by young papaya fruits.There is an effect of giving moringa leaf extract and young papaya fruit on increasing breast milk production in breastfeeding mothers at the Munjul Health Center. It is hoped that breastfeeding mothers can implement the administration of moringa leaf extract and young papaya fruits to increase breast milk production.
